Position: Vice President of Engineering (Dallas Only)

Job Description

We're a rapidly growing Fin Tech SaaS company is looking for a Vice President of Engineering to lead and scale its technical teams. Our company developstech-driven solutions for financial services, providing strategic insights that help businesses grow.

As VP of Engineering, you willset the vision, lead execution, and foster a high-performance engineering culture. You’ll work closely with executive leadership to ensure that engineering strategies align with company goals, while managing technical teams across multiple time zones. This is an opportunity to have a direct impact on an expanding, profitable company with a strong market presence.

Responsibilities
  • Lead our Software Engineering team delivering quality software on time and prioritizing effectively. You will partner with our Executive Team to create aggressive goals that will expand our product’s reach and uplevels our current offerings.
  • Hire and grow Engineering Managers and Senior Engineers to build and continue to reinforce a strong technical leadership core and culture that will ensure the broader engineering organization is scaling and feels rewarded in their work.
  • Champion engineering excellence . In partnership with your engineering leaders, you will establish metrics, processes and targeted engagement to reduce technical debt. You will oversee the coordination of all engineering work streams and maintain a high bar for quality.
  • Work closely with our Product leaders and Tech leaders to ensure resources are allocated to meet company priorities.
  • Be a company leader . You will provide visibility into the engineering team’s work in a way that is clear and builds trust with leaders and other departments. You will proactively identify bottlenecks, pitfalls, and other potential issues and work with the CEO and President to address them.
  • Manage engineering budget . You will oversee the team budget, including headcount, infrastructure, and software costs.
  • Be cutting edge . R&D of AI / ML tools like Cursor, ChatGPT Canvas, etc to quickly iterate with Product leaders and Tech leaders.
Qualifications
  • Experience growing and managing an engineering organization with multiple leaders in place. Have led and managed a scaled engineering team of at least
    50-100 headcount. Our current Engineering Team is ~30 and are both local in Dallas + International.
  • Experience leading multi-time zone technical teams with a large global footprint.
  • Proven leadership abilities, including effective knowledge sharing and leading by example through creating open forums for discussion. At least
    10+ years of technical leadership experience managing teams of 50+ in a Fin Tech product company.
  • Extensive experience scaling an inclusive software engineering team, building and developing leaders, and investing in broader technical mentorship.
  • An eye and respect for Product. You will have a proven track record of ensuring product / software have been deployed on time and resourced efficiently and effectively.
  • Lead the product / software delivery for an organization. Ensuring the company met deadlines and committed to external parties.
  • Experience with cloud-based technologies (Azure / AWS), Microsoft stack, Angular and willingness to roll up your sleeves and help when necessary.
Skills
  • 12+ years of engineering execution or engineering management experience at an enterprise or consumer technology company.
  • Bank debt / Private Credit experience is highly preferable.
  • Strong accountability, work ethic, sense of urgency with little to no entitlement.
  • Excellent communication, people, and problem resolution skills.
  • Strong ability to lead, develop and mentor a technical community.
  • Exceptional ability to attract and retain credible technical talent.
  • Bachelor’s degree (or higher) is required.
  • Preferably based in the Dallas-Fort Worth area.
